summaryrefslogtreecommitdiff
path: root/README.md
diff options
context:
space:
mode:
authorAlex Kavanagh <alex@ajkavanagh.co.uk>2016-07-13 16:43:08 +0000
committerAlex Kavanagh <alex@ajkavanagh.co.uk>2016-07-13 16:43:08 +0000
commita1d134bccdbf603ba04a18cb8fb49c23607084ca (patch)
tree57628a5bc41c166bc200e56af2b34293c07bf1bf /README.md
parentbacbfac125f2e9de9cd68964c9b429230df6daf5 (diff)
Update the charm to work with renamed barbican-hsm interface
The barbican-hsm-plugin interface was changed to barbican-hsm.
Diffstat (limited to 'README.md')
-rw-r--r--README.md6
1 files changed, 3 insertions, 3 deletions
diff --git a/README.md b/README.md
index 362977d..cf897db 100644
--- a/README.md
+++ b/README.md
@@ -10,7 +10,7 @@ Systems. It is intended to provide a example on how to plug an HSM into
10Barbican. 10Barbican.
11 11
12In particular, the SoftHSM2 plugin charm (as a subordinate) implements the 12In particular, the SoftHSM2 plugin charm (as a subordinate) implements the
13barbican-hsm-plugin interface which transfers the credentials to the Barbican 13barbican-hsm interface which transfers the credentials to the Barbican
14charm to be able to access the the HSM. 14charm to be able to access the the HSM.
15 15
16From [the GitHub page](https://github.com/opendnssec/SoftHSMv2): 16From [the GitHub page](https://github.com/opendnssec/SoftHSMv2):
@@ -46,11 +46,11 @@ http://bugs.launchpad.net/charms/+source/barbican/).
46Barbican communicates with HSM devices via a local (to Barbican) PKCS11 46Barbican communicates with HSM devices via a local (to Barbican) PKCS11
47library. Thus an HSM plugin needs to be local to the unit that a Barbican is 47library. Thus an HSM plugin needs to be local to the unit that a Barbican is
48installed on, and so a plugin charm is subordinate to the Barbican charm. A 48installed on, and so a plugin charm is subordinate to the Barbican charm. A
49plugin provides the barbican-hsm-plugin interface that provides sufficient 49plugin provides the barbican-hsm interface that provides sufficient
50details to the Barbican charm to be able to configure barbican to access the 50details to the Barbican charm to be able to configure barbican to access the
51HSM's PKCS11 libary. 51HSM's PKCS11 libary.
52 52
53The barbican-hsm-plugin interface transfers `login`, `slot_id` and 53The barbican-hsm interface transfers `login`, `slot_id` and
54`library_path` parameters to the Barbican charm, which uses them to configure 54`library_path` parameters to the Barbican charm, which uses them to configure
55Barbican to access the PKCS11 compliant library of the HSM. 55Barbican to access the PKCS11 compliant library of the HSM.
56 56